The company is a joint venture with Birmingham-based Dunlop Aircraft Tyres, HAECO (Hong Kong Aircraft Engineering Company) and TAECO (Taikoo (Xiamen) Aircraft Engineering Company). Based in Jinjiang, Fujian Province, the company’s new facility is already distributing new tyres throughout the Asia Pacific region and is reportedly going through the approvals process to start retreading.
“KK will provide the leadership and focus that is required to help build our market share in Asia Pacific and to make us a force in aircraft tyre retreading in the region,” said Dunlop Aircraft Tyres’ chairman, Ian Edmondson. “This facility will provide aircraft operators and MROs with greater choice of tyres and, for the first time, local retreading in China at a site that is ideally located for quick and easy shipping to and from most parts of the region.” (Tyres & Accessories/Staffordshire, U.K.)
